Romantic Western-style dresses are an end-of-summer staple

Western romance- inspired dresses are making a comeback. Find grace in detailed ruffles, body-skimming silhouettes, floral prints and lace and embroidery textures. Relaxed sleeves, split hems and cinched busts allow for a slightly fitted yet comfy shape.

As delicate as these romantic dresses are, they can be grunged up with animal print earrings, combat-style boots or a choker necklace. When the weather cools down, pair with fall pieces like an oversized denim jacket, a taupe-colored hat or leather boots.

Wear these versatile, modernized prairie dresses to the office, fall weddings, on date night or to street festivals — the airy feel makes them comfortable to walk and travel in.
